The data development process refers to the systematic approach of collecting, analyzing, and managing data to derive insights and support decision-making. It typically involves several stages, including data collection, data cleaning, data integration, data analysis, and data visualization. This iterative process ensures that data is accurate, relevant, and actionable, ultimately helping organizations to make informed decisions based on reliable information. Effective communication and collaboration among stakeholders are also crucial throughout the process.

Why normalizations are important for database development?

Normalisation is process of taking data from a problem and reducing it to a set of relations. Meanwhile ensuring data integrity and eliminating data redundancy.


What is a schema in programming and how does it impact the development process?

A schema in programming is a blueprint or structure that defines the organization and relationships of data within a database. It impacts the development process by providing a framework for designing and implementing the database, ensuring data consistency and integrity, and guiding developers in writing efficient and accurate code.


What is a type in programming and how does it impact the development process?

In programming, a type is a classification that defines the kind of data a variable can hold. Types impact the development process by ensuring that data is used correctly and helping to catch errors early on. By specifying types, developers can write more reliable and efficient code.

How would you describe the POST process?

In the context of web development, the POST process is a request method used to submit data to the server for processing. It sends data in the body of the request, allowing for more data to be transferred compared to the GET method. The server processes the data sent through POST and can then respond accordingly.

What of the is not a way scientists collect data theory development computer models controlled experiments observations in nature?

The option that is not a way scientists collect data is "theory development." While theory development is an essential part of the scientific process, it involves formulating explanations and predictions based on existing data rather than collecting new data itself. In contrast, computer models, controlled experiments, and observations in nature are all methods used to gather empirical data.
